Output 128f33c779bb9a2b4d74ab7e841338917a55d8daa7f833d1794db4800f021f5a:0

value
10402580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e6f21d1794d812a65c6843c776f8fa08c37140 OP_EQUAL
address
MKk24ZwdQJFjSRajRVQrGKwVZ3wDok2a1g
transaction
128f33c779bb9a2b4d74ab7e841338917a55d8daa7f833d1794db4800f021f5a
spent
true